Rýchly začiatok: Vytvorenie makra

Dôležité: Tento článok je strojovo preložený, prečítajte si vyhlásenie. Anglickú verziu tohto článku nájdete tu a môžete ju použiť ako referenciu.

Ak máte úlohy v programe Microsoft Excel, ktoré vykonávate opakovane, môžete zaznamenať makro na automatizáciu týchto úloh. Makro predstavuje akciu alebo množinu akcií, ktoré môžete spúšťať ľubovoľný počet krát. Keď vytvárate makro, zaznamenávate kliknutia myšou a stlačenia klávesov. Po vytvorení makra môžete makro meniť a vykonávať menšie zmeny spôsobu, akým funguje.

Predpokladajme, že každý mesiac budete vytvárať zostavu pre vedúceho účtovníka. Chcete formátovať mená zákazníkov s nezaplatenými záväzkami červeným písmom a súčasne chcete použiť tučné písmo. Môžete vytvoriť a potom spustiť makro, ktoré rýchlym spôsobom použije tieto zmeny formátovania vo vybratých bunkách.

Ako?

Vzhľad ikony

Pred záznamom makra   

Makrá a nástroje programu VBA nájdete na karte Vývojár, ktorá je predvolene skrytá, preto je prvým krokom jej zapnutie. Ďalšie informácie nájdete v téme Zobrazenie karty Vývojár.

Karta Vývojár na páse s nástrojmi

Vzhľad ikony

Zaznamenanie makra   

  1. V skupine Kód na karte Vývojár kliknite na položku Zaznamenať makro.

  2. Voliteľne môžete zadať názov makra v poli Názov makra, klávesovú skratku v poli Klávesová skratka a popis v poli Popis. Kliknutím na tlačidlo OK sa spustí nahrávanie záznamu.

    Záznam makra

  3. Vykonajte akcie, ktoré chcete zautomatizovať, napríklad zadávanie často používaného textu alebo vypĺňanie údajového stĺpca.

  4. Na karte Vývojár kliknite na položku Zastaviť nahrávanie.

    Zastavenie nahrávania

Vzhľad ikony

Podrobný pohľad makro   

Vďaka úpravám makra sa môžete dozvedieť viac o jazyku programovania Visual Basic.

Ak chcete upraviť makro, v skupine Kód na karte Vývojár kliknite na položku Makrá, vyberte názov makra a kliknite na položku Úpravy. Spustí sa editor jazyka Visual Basic.

Zistite, ako sa zaznamenané akcie zobrazujú vo forme kódu. Niektoré kódy vám môžu byť jasné a niektoré sa vám môžu zdať záhadné.

Experimentujte s kódom, zavrite editor jazyka Visual Basic a znova spustite makro. Sledujte, či sa vykoná odlišná akcia!

Ďalšie kroky

Ako?

Vzhľad ikony

Pred záznamom makra   

Overte, či sa na páse s nástrojmi zobrazuje karta Vývojár. Karta Vývojár sa predvolene nezobrazuje, a preto postupujte takto:

  1. Prejdite do programu Excel > nastavenia... > Pás s nástrojmi a panela s nástrojmi.

  2. V kategórii Prispôsobiť pás s nástrojmi v zozname Hlavné karty začiarknite políčko vývojár a potom kliknite na tlačidlo Uložiť.

Vzhľad ikony

Zaznamenanie makra   

  1. Na karte Vývojár kliknite na položku Zaznamenať makro.

  2. Voliteľne môžete zadať názov makra v poli Názov makra, klávesovú skratku v poli Klávesová skratka a popis v poli Popis. Kliknutím na tlačidlo OK sa spustí nahrávanie záznamu.

  3. Vykonajte akcie, ktoré chcete zautomatizovať, napríklad zadávanie často používaného textu alebo vypĺňanie údajového stĺpca.

  4. V skupine Kód na karte Vývojár kliknite na položku Zastaviť záznam.

Vzhľad ikony

Podrobný pohľad makro   

Vďaka úpravám makra sa môžete dozvedieť viac o jazyku programovania Visual Basic.

Môžete upraviť makro, na karte vývojár kliknite na položku makrá vyberte názov makra a kliknite na položku Upraviť. Spustí sa Editor jazyka Visual Basic.

Zistite, ako sa zaznamenané akcie zobrazujú vo forme kódu. Niektoré kódy vám môžu byť jasné a niektoré sa vám môžu zdať záhadné.

Experimentujte s kódom, zavrite editor jazyka Visual Basic a znova spustite makro. Sledujte, či sa vykoná odlišná akcia!

Ďalšie kroky

Ďalšie informácie o vytváraní a spúšťanie makier. Pozrite si tému Vytvorenie, spustiť, úprava alebo odstránenie makra.

Potrebujete ďalšiu pomoc?

Vždy sa môžete opýtať odborníka v komunite technikov pre Excel, získať podporu v rámci komunity lokality Answers alebo navrhnúť novú funkciu či vylepšenie na lokalite Excel User Voice.

Poznámka: Vyhlásenie týkajúce sa strojového prekladu: Tento článok bol preložený počítačovým systémom bez zásahu človeka. Poskytovaním týchto strojových prekladov umožňuje spoločnosť Microsoft aj používateľom, ktorí nehovoria po anglicky, využívať obsah o produktoch, službách a technológiách spoločnosti Microsoft. Článok bol preložený strojovo, môže preto obsahovať chyby týkajúce sa slovnej zásoby, syntaxe alebo gramatiky.

Rozšírte svoje zručnosti
Preskúmať školenie
Buďte medzi prvými, ktorí získajú nové funkcie
Pridajte sa k insiderom pre Office

Boli tieto informácie užitočné?

Ďakujeme za vaše pripomienky!

Ďakujeme vám za pripomienky. Pravdepodobne vám pomôže, ak vás spojíme s pracovníkom podpory pre Office.

×